What is the weight at position 6 for the C-130H at a height of 76"?

Explanation:
To determine the weight at position 6 for the C-130H at a height of 76 inches, it is essential to understand the specific loading instructions and weight distribution characteristics of the aircraft. The C-130H has defined weight limits for various stations, and position 6 is typically associated with a specific cargo configuration. In military aircraft like the C-130H, each cargo position is designed to hold a certain weight safely while adhering to the overall balance and structural integrity requirements of the aircraft. The weight of 4,664 lbs at position 6 aligns with the standard limits set for that specific position when the aircraft is loaded correctly. This answer considers the aircraft's loading diagrams and weight and balance manuals, which provide essential data for calculating the maximum allowable payload at various positions. When evaluating the options, the other weights listed (such as 5,000 lbs, 8,000 lbs, and 6,500 lbs) exceed the calculated limits for position 6, thus making 4,664 lbs the most accurate and applicable choice for the given configuration.
